Specified Contract Terms definition

Specified Contract Terms means the covenants, terms and provisions of any indenture, credit agreement or any other agreement, document or instrument evidencing, governing the rights of the holders of or otherwise relating to any Indebtedness of the Company or any of its Subsidiaries.
Specified Contract Terms means the covenants, terms and provisions of any indenture, credit agreement or any other agreement, document or instrument evidencing, governing the rights of the holders of or otherwise relating to any Indebtedness of the Company or any of its Subsidiaries as in effect on the date hereof or, solely to the extent such terms are not materially less favorable to the Holders for purposes of Section 6(d) hereof, any amendments thereto or refinancings or replacements thereof.
